Functional anatomy of speech, language, and hearing‐a primer, Edited by William H. Perkins and Raymond D. Kent, 505 pp. Little Brown/College‐Hill Press, San Diego, California, 1986. $31.00

Abstract: This primer represents a unique idea in educational materials. It is intended to provide students of speech and language pathology with "ONLY as much anatomy, physiology, and acoustics as is necessary to understand how the equipment functions to produce and understand speech."
